Important Business News Extracts January 08, 2020

Average inflation up, marginally, in 2019 The average inflation rate has increased by 0.04 percentage points for the 12 months in the just-concluded year 2019 to 5.59 per cent due to some volatility in commodity markets in the country, official figures show. Important Business News Extracts February 05, 2020

RMG hiccups pull down July-Jan export receipts The country’s merchandise shipments fell by 5.21 per cent in the first seven months of the current fiscal year over that of the same period of last fiscal year (FY).
